From 1973, Centuri's original liftin' body design. Avast! I had one back then but never got a "glide" out o' it.
Made from online scans from t' JimZ website. Arrr! Easy build, beefed up t' shroud with acrylic paint and Scotch tape.

Boosted at an angle towards mid power pads. Well, blow me down! Ejected at 100', turned over and went into a liftin' body glide.
Steep, a little nose down. Aye aye! Still a success! Everyone be surprised, me bucko, includin' me. I'll add a little more clay t' brin' t' nose up. This flight had .25 oz. Ahoy! o' clay weight at t' aft o' t' shroud.
